this is a little bit difficult and I hope I can clarify what's my
problem...
I want to fork an extra process for computations over the scene graph.
Computations will not change the scene graph - only access nodes.
Computations are expected to be time-consuming. That's why it should be
possible to run this process with a lower rate than the frame rate.
May be, it could be useful to have a copy of scene graph contents to be
sure to complete one computation run on a consistent scene graph.
I just have read man pfMultiprocess and man pfIsectFunc.
Sounds a lot if an extra ISECT process could be the suitable start.
Any comments, suggestions, warnings, recommendations or anything else?
